FSG Makes Formal Announcement on James, RedBird Partners Investment

March 31, 2021 by Terry Lyons

BOSTON – Fenway Sports Group (FSG), a global sports, marketing, media, entertainment, and real estate platform, announced a significant investment into the company by RedBird Capital Partners (RedBird). The deal is part of an ongoing strategic alliance between the two companies that will focus on the active pursuit of growth opportunities for FSG.

Embed from Getty Images

In addition to the organic growth anticipated for FSG’s current portfolio, the partnership with RedBird will enhance the company’s ability to develop and launch new businesses modeled after successful growth companies built by Gerry Cardinale and RedBird. FSG and RedBird will also develop opportunities for strategic acquisitions in sports, including teams and venues, media and related businesses that enhance or extend FSG’s existing platform.

The investment by RedBird into FSG is based on an enterprise valuation for FSG of $7.35 billion. As part of the overall transaction, LeBron James, Maverick Carter and their longtime business partner Paul Wachter will exchange a previously held interest in Liverpool Football Club and become part of FSG’s ownership group along with RedBird.

FSG leadership, comprised of Principal Owner John W. Henry, Chairman Tom Werner and President Mike Gordon said, “Over the years, Fenway Sports Group has been able to attract a dedicated group of executives and partnerships seeking to compete for titles in the most challenging and rewarding landscapes. Our strategic partnership with Gerry and the entire team at RedBird will enhance our ability to pursue future growth opportunities in a more accelerated way but with the same selectiveness that has served us so well.

“We are also pleased to welcome to our ownership group LeBron, Maverick and Paul, with whom we have enjoyed a successful collaboration for well over a decade. Their addition is an important milestone for FSG and expands and deepens a longtime friendship and relationship that began in 2010.

“To our fans and supporters: Winning continues to be the driving force for all of us. The growth of FSG as an organization allows us to further strengthen our resources and commitment to the communities we serve, and we look forward to having these talented new partners join us in the next chapter of FSG’s evolution.”

Gerry Cardinale, Founder and Managing Partner of RedBird, said, “Fenway Sports Group is unique not only for the quality of its sports properties and assets, but for the highly disciplined, results-oriented organization that John, Tom, Mike and the FSG team have built over the past 20 years. RedBird shares the same passion for performance-driven investing, business operations, fan experience and service to the community. We look forward to contributing our experience growing premier sports properties and working alongside this tremendous leadership team, including our fellow new owners LeBron, Maverick and Paul.”

“Working with Fenway Sports Group for the past decade has taught LeBron and me so much about the business on a global scale, and we’ve always believed it would lead to something bigger,” said Maverick Carter. “We are proud to be part of this iconic ownership group and are excited about the opportunities that come with that to continue creating change and empowering people of every race, gender and background to be part of the process.”

The transactions were unanimously voted on by FSG partners on Tuesday, March 16, 2021. The deal is scheduled to close on Wednesday, March 31, 2021. Bank of America served as financial advisor to FSG, and Goldman Sachs served as financial advisor to RedBird on the transaction. Shearman & Sterling served as legal advisor to FSG, while Fried Frank served as legal advisor to RedBird.

In addition to new owners RedBird Capital, LeBron James, Maverick Carter and Paul Wachter, as a part of this transaction Red Sox President & CEO Sam Kennedy will be converting his previously held long-term incentive plan interests into an interest in FSG and will become part of the FSG ownership group.

Red Sox Lose to ATL on Last Day of Spring Training

March 30, 2021 by Terry Lyons

FORT MYERS – The Boston Red Sox (16-11) dropped a 5-3 decision to the Atlanta Braves (15-13) in the final Spring Training Grapefruit League game for both  teams today at jetBlue Park. The Red Sox will now pack-up the gear and head north to Fenway Park for Thursday’s home opener against the Baltimore Orioles. Although today’s forecast in Boston was for a perfect spring day, Thursday’s weather calls for afternoon showers and an 80% chance of rain. First pitch is schedule for 2:10pm Thursday.

Embed from Getty Images

Braves reliever Drew Smyly earned the win and Boston RP Martin Perez took the loss while Braves ace Mike Soroka earned a save in the seven inning game. OF Jarren Duran homered off Soroka in the 7th. Perez allowed four runs on four hits in 5.0 innings pitched. He walked two and struck-out five Braves but allowed a two-run homer to Ozzie Albies in the 5th inning.

On Monday, Boston defeated Atlanta, 4-0, behind three long-balls in the 3rd inning and solid pitching. With one out and no base runners, infielder Enrique Rodriguez homered to left field, J.D. Martinez solo homered to left-center and after a Xander Bogaerts single, utility man Marwin Gonzalez homered to right to complete the scoring.

Tanner Houck went 4.1 innings to start for the Sox and he was relived by Kaleb Ort (0.2 inn), Austin Brice (1.0 inn) and Darwinzon Hernandez (1.o inn) to complete the four-hit shutout in a 7 inning game. The Braves used six pitchers and a total of 21 players in the home loss.

Sports Biz: Draft Kings Acquires VSiN

March 30, 2021 by Terry Lyons

BOSTON – DraftKings announced that it has acquired Vegas Sports Information Network (VSiN) , a multi-platform broadcast and content company delivering trusted sports betting news, analysis, and data to U.S. sports bettors since 2017. The acquisition will enable DraftKings, which is live with mobile and/or retail sports betting in 14 states, to further build out its content capabilities and will augment VSiN’s ability to broaden their audience alongside the expansion of legal sports betting in the U.S.

Embed from Getty Images

“VSiN creates authentic and credible content that resonates with sports bettors at every level, whether they’re experienced or new to sports betting,” said Jason Robins, DraftKings’ co-founder, CEO and Chairman of the Board. “In addition to its brand equity among sports bettors and engaging talent roster, VSiN also has an established infrastructure that DraftKings can immediately help expand, in the hopes of adding value to consumers who are looking to become more knowledgeable about sports betting.”

VSiN, which operates out of Las Vegas, develops, produces, and distributes up to 18+ hours of live linear sports betting content each day. In addition to its 24/7 stream, VSiN’s original content is accessible through multiple video and audio channels including Comcast Xfinity, Sling TV, fuboTV, Rogers’ Sportsnet, MSG Networks, NESN, AT&T Pittsburgh, Marquee Sports Network, a dedicated channel on iHeartRadio and TuneIn, as well as terrestrial radio stations throughout the country, and its growing slate of podcasts and betcasts. VSiN’s current talent roster includes Brent Musburger, legendary sports broadcaster; Michael Lombardi, former NFL executive; Gill Alexander, host of the Beating the Book podcast; and Pauly Howard and Mitch Moss, co-hosts of VSiN’s popular morning show, Follow The Money.

“We created VSiN as a destination for sports bettors to find the most credible content to help inform their wagering decisions,” said Brian Musburger, CEO of VSiN. “Harnessing the power and network of the DraftKings brand will allow us to reach an even wider audience with our unique content.”

DraftKings’ vision is for Musburger and his leadership team to continue to manage day-to-day operations while maintaining editorial independence. DraftKings intends to fully integrate VSiN’s current employee base located in Las Vegas, including its on-air talent, into its 2,600 person global workforce. Since opening a Las Vegas office in January 2020, DraftKings has grown its local employee base by 132%. The Company also recently announced a multi-year agreement to become a primary sponsor of the Center for Gaming Innovation, housed within the International Gaming Institute at the University of Nevada, Las Vegas.

Red Sox: Coming Down the Stretch from Spring Training to Opening Day

March 29, 2021 by Terry Lyons

FORT MYERS – The Boston Red Sox won each of their last two games following a two-game losing streak. Boston has not lost more than two consecutive games at any point this spring.

Embed from Getty Images

Today marks the eighth of nine scheduled Grapefruit League meetings between the Red Sox and Braves (Red Sox lead, 4-3). The teams will close out their spring training schedule against each other today in North Port and tomorrow at jetBlue Park.
The Sox and Braves will play each other 4 times in the regular season, with 2 games at Fenway Park (May 25-26) and 2 at Truist Park (June 15-16). The Sox went 2-4 vs. ATL in 2020, finishing the season by taking 2 of 3 games in Atlanta from September 25-27.

Sox Manager Alex Cora announced that SP Nathan Eovaldi will start the Red Sox’ Opening Day game against the Orioles on April 1. Eovaldi’s 1st career Opening Day start came last year against BAL, when he allowed 1 run in 6.0 IP. In his final 4 starts of 2020, Eovaldi posted a 0.86 ERA (2 ER/21.0 IP) with 25 SO and 2 BB, allowing 0 runs in his final 13.0 IP. On the season, he averaged a career- best 9.68 SO/9.0 IP and ranked 7th in the majors in SO/ BB ratio (7.43), walking only 7 of his 199 batters faced.

Spring Training: Red Sox Snap Two-Game Skid with Win Over Pirates

March 28, 2021 by Terry Lyons

BRADENTON – The Boston Red Sox snapped a two-game skid with a 7-4 win at Pittsburgh, to continue their trend to not lose more than two consecutive games at any point this spring. Boston went 3-5 in their first eight Grapefruit League games but have since gone 11-5-1.

YouTube player

Since March 10, Boston’s 11 wins rank second in MLB behind only the Oakland A’s (12-4-1). The only teams with more than 14 wins this spring are Toronto(15) and Oakland (15).

Sox 1B Bobby Dalbec leads the majors in runs scored (15) and RBI (16) and is tied for the lead with seven HRs (also Joc Pederson). Dalbec ranks No. 2 in SLG (.822) and No. 3 in OPS (1.214). He also leads the Red Sox in Batting Average (.311) while Kiké Hernández ranks eighth in the majors in OBP (.442) and has recorded more walks (9) than strikeouts (8).

Utility man Michael Chavis ranks in a tie for third in the majors with six HRs (tied with Corey Seager and Josh Bell).

Chavis’ 36 total bases rank 5th in MLB spring training.

Celtics Rally for Win at OKC

March 28, 2021 by Terry Lyons

OKLAHOMA CITY – Jayson  Tatum scored 20 of his 27 points in the second half and the Boston Celtics rallied in the fourth quarter to beat the Oklahoma City Thunder 111-94. Celtics All-Star swingman Jaylen Brown added 25 points to help the Celtics close out a four-game trip and even their season record. Boston had lost five of six before winning at Milwaukee on Friday and at Oklahoma City on Saturday.

YouTube player

OKC’s Moses Brown scored a career-high 21 points and tied a Thunder record with 23 rebounds. The team announced before the game that veteran center Al Horford will be inactive the rest of the season while the team’s young players develop. Brown moved into the starting lineup and set a franchise record for rebounds in a half with 19 before the break.

Theo Maledon chipped-in with 22 points for Oklahoma City.

The Thunder led 80-76 heading into the fourth quarter. Jaylen Brown kept the Celtics in it with 13 points in the third.

Bruins Hand Sabres 17th Straight Loss

March 28, 2021 by Terry Lyons

BOSTON – Back on February 23, 2021, the weather bureau issued warnings for the Northern Plains, there was a report on the decline on exports and soybean futures rose on news of the virus woes in Brazil. That Tuesday evening, the Buffalo Sabres defeated the Devils, 4-1, in New Jersey. It was their last win.

YouTube player

The Buffalo Sabres lost their 17th consecutive game Saturday, twice blowing a single goal lead before Boston’s Craig Smith scored with 3:50 left to snap a third-period tie and give the Bruins a 3-2 victory. The fact that the Sabres have not won since Feb. 23, ties the 18th longest losing streak in NHL history. It was just the fifth time during that span that the Sabres have managed to lose by only one goal.

The Sabres have been without former Boston U star Jack Eichel since early March and had been forced to use a fourth-string goalie, Dustin Tokarski before Linus Ullmark returned tonight. Kyle Okposo had missed three games with an injury.

The Bruins play New Jersey today at TD Garden.

NBA: Celtics Strike Buck

March 27, 2021 by Terry Lyons

MILWAUKEE – Boston struck Buck, errr … back.

A night after the Boston Celtics lost to the Milwaukee Bucks at the TD Garden in New England, Jayson Tatum scored 34 points and added six rebounds, Marcus Smart had 23 and the Boston Celtics beat Milwaukee 122-114 on Friday night and snapped a Bucks’ eight-game winning streak and spilt the two-game home and home mini-series.

The Celtics, who led 60-55 at the half, hit nine of 14 three-pointers in the third quarter to build the lead to 103-89 entering the final period.

YouTube player

Newly acquired Celtics bigman Moe Wagner and veteran Celtics guard Smart extended Boston’s lead to 118-97 with three-pointers in the fourth quarter. Boston’s All-Star guard Kemba Walker added 21 points, and All-Star swingman Jaylen Brown had 18 for the Celtics.

Boston finished 22 of 47 from beyond the arc. Smart was 7 for 10, and Brown and Tatum added four apiece.

As Spring Training Winds Down, Boston Red Sox Lose to Minnesota Twins

March 26, 2021 by Terry Lyons

FORT MYERS – Minnesota Twins SP Randy Dobnak gave up one hit in five innings, a solo homer by Boston’s Bobby Dalbec, as Minnesota prevailed as spring training winds down. The Twins’ Josh Donaldson and the Red Sox’s Jonathan Arauz and Cesar Puello also homered as the Twins snapped a three-game Boston win streak with last night’s 7-4 decision. Boston is (6-3) in their last 9 games and 10-4-1 in their last 15.

YouTube player

Boston remains one of six teams with 13 wins (or more). The only teams with more wins are the Royals (14-7- 3) and Blue Jays (14-8-2). Boston has five games remaining in spring training before opening the regular season at home on Thursday, April 1, against the Orioles.

Celtics Acquire Fournier From Magic

March 26, 2021 by Terry Lyons

BOSTON – (Official News Release) – The Boston Celtics acquired guard Evan Fournier from the Orlando Magic in exchange for guard Jeff Teague and two future second round draft picks, the team announced.

Embed from Getty Images

“Evan has established himself as a highly-efficient scorer, whose combination of shooting and playmaking will make an immediate impact on this team,” said Celtics President of Basketball Operations Danny Ainge. “He’s someone who has consistently produced on the offensive end, and we think his unique abilities will fit in seamlessly with our current group.”

A nine-year veteran from Saint-Maurice, France, Fournier (6-7, 205) is averaging a career-high 19.7 points on 46.1% shooting (38.8% 3-PT) in 26 games played with Orlando this season (all starts). His 2.9 rebounds, 3.7 assists, and 2.8 three-point field goals in 2020-21 also represent career-high averages.

Fournier has reached the 20-point mark 14 times in 26 games in 2020-21, with both of his 30-point efforts occurring over the last four contests. He has connected on at least five 3-point field goals in five games this season, including a career-high six 3-pointers made (of 8) against Brooklyn on March 19.

Originally drafted by Denver with the 20th overall pick in the 2012 NBA Draft, Fournier has produced 14.4 points (45.0% FG, 37.6% 3-PT, 80.6% FT), 2.7 rebounds, 2.7 assists, while averaging 28.5 minutes played in nine seasons with the Nuggets and Magic. The 28-year-old is one of nine NBA players to average 15.0 points and shoot 35.0% from beyond the arc in each of the last five seasons since 2015-16.

Signed as a free agent on Nov. 30, Teague averaged 6.9 points (41.5% FG, 46.4% 3-PT), 1.7 rebounds, and 2.1 assists in 34 games (five starts) during his lone season with the Celtics.
